Public Works International Exhibition
Algiers - APS

The 12th Public Works International Exhibition of Algiers (SITP) which will be held from 19 to 23 in the Exhibition Centre will bring together 429 participants, including 212 foreigners, the organizers said.
Organized by the Ministry of Public Works in collaboration with the Algerian Company of Fairs and Exports (Safex), this event of industry professionals will be placed under of theme of "Public Works, development and modernity."
The Exhibition, which will be marked by a strong presence, particularly of the Chinese companies (56 participants), Italian companies (45 participants) and the French ones (43 participants), will be "an opportunity for operators and domestic exhibitors to forge partnerships and build business links with their foreign counterparts in the activities of engineering, equipment, studies of projects, training and retraining," the same source added.
Germany (22 participants), Turkey (8 participants), Spain (11 participants), India (3 participants), Tunisia (3 participants), Lebanon (1 participant ), Belgium (1 participant), Austria (1 participant), Holland (1 participant), Denmark (1 participant), Indonesia (1 participant), Portugal (8 participants), Greece (4 participants), Russia (1 participant), the US (1 participant), and finally Poland (1 participant) are also expected at this annual exhibition.
"The interest now granted to the Algerian public works market is reflected by the strong foreign participation with 212 exhibitors from 19 countries on a total 429 exhibitors, nearly 50% of the number of participants," the source said.
The latest edition of SITP had attracted more than 380 exhibitors, including 140 foreign exhibitors from 14 countries.
To be held over a total area of ​​26,802 m2, the exhibition will also feature various industries including the Algerian national agency of highways, the Agency for Highway Management, the National Institution of Technical Supervision of Public Works and the National Laboratory maritime Studies.
